Tutorial for function approximation with Chebyshev orthogonal polynomials, written in Matlab. Strongly inspired by the chebfun project (www.chebfun.org). These methods use barycentric interpolation, which allows for efficient computation and numerical stability, even for high-order approximations. Includes functions for function approximation, data fitting, integration, differentiation, and interpolation.
I use these approximations for solving ordinary differential equations and in the background of trajectory optimization problems.
